Change the lives of Argentina's at-risk youth when you volunteer with our Youth Outreach Program in Buenos Aires.
As a volunteer with our Youth Outreach Program, you will have the opportunity to help Argentina’s at-risk children and teens reach their potential, while also working toward breaking the cycle of poverty that affects so much of the country. Volunteers will work in a hands-on environment at community centers, soup kitchens, halfway houses, and shelters. You will also organize recreational activities, conduct educational workshops, and prepare and serve meals, among many other tasks. Regardless of the activities in which you participate, you will be an important role model for many young Argentineans.
As a volunteer you can*:
Organize youth recreational and/or educational activities
Play sports and games with children
Give informal English lessons
Organize book drives
Collect donations of food, clothing, and other materials (crayons, markers, colored paper, notebooks, scissors, pencils, toys, etc.)
Develop and teach special workshops (songs, drama, dance, exercise, photography, drawing, writing, art, languages, etc.)
Prepare and serve snacks and meals
Work on various administrative tasks
Potentially organize field trips
* Exact activities will depend on time of year and duration of project.
